Jalen Pitre Becomes the NFL's First Guardian Cap Athlete

via Fox News·Aug 4

Houston Texans safety Jalen Pitre was named the NFL's first Guardian Cap athlete, a role tied to the padded helmet covers the league has pushed into practices to reduce head impacts. Pitre framed the designation as part of the "evolution of the game," a phrase that carries weight for a position built on collisions.
